Question 482434: Jodie bikes 8 km/h faster than robert in the same time it takes robert to bike 30km, Jodie can bike 54km. How fast does each bicyclist travel?

You can put this solution on YOUR website! Jodie bikes 8 km/h faster than robert in the same time it takes robert to bike 30km, Jodie can bike 54km.
How fast does each bicyclist travel?
:
Let s = R's speed
then
(s+8) = J's speed
:
Write a time equation; time = dist/speed
:
J's time = R's time =
Cross multiply
54s = 30(s+8)
54s = 30s + 240
54s - 30s = 240
24s = 240
s =
s = 10 mph is R's speed
then
10 + 8 = 18 mph is J's speed
:
:
Confirm our solutions by finding the time of each, they should be equal
54/18 = 3 hrs
30/10 = 3 hrs
